The Atlas Copco D303‑DL‑BASIC, also referenced as D303DLBASIC, is a compact programmable logic controller (PLC) designed for simple automation and control tasks in industrial environments. This controller is part of Atlas Copco's D‑series family, offering a cost‑effective solution for standalone machine control, conveyor systems, and auxiliary equipment. Its small footprint, built‑in I/O, and easy‑to‑use programming environment make it accessible for both OEMs and end‑users who need reliable, basic control functionality.
The D303‑DL‑BASIC features a rugged plastic housing with a transparent cover for easy status viewing. It includes a set of integrated digital inputs and outputs, as well as communication ports for programming and interaction with operator panels. The unit is designed for DIN‑rail mounting, with spring‑clamp terminals for secure wiring. It operates on a 24 VDC supply and consumes minimal power.
Supply Voltage: 24 VDC ±20%
Digital Inputs: 6 (24 VDC, sink/source)
Digital Outputs: 4 (relay, 2 A @ 250 VAC)
Input Filter: 1 ms (defeatable)
Output Protection: Short‑circuit and overload
Communication: RS‑485 Modbus RTU, USB (programming)
Programming Language: Ladder logic (IEC 61131‑3 compliant)
Memory: 128 KB program, 32 KB data
Real‑Time Clock: Yes (battery‑backed)
Operating Temperature: -10 °C to +55 °C
Protection: IP20
Dimensions: 110 x 90 x 55 mm
The controller is programmed using Atlas Copco’s D‑Studio software, which provides a user‑friendly ladder logic editor with online monitoring and debugging capabilities. Users can create simple control sequences, timers, counters, and arithmetic functions. The software includes a library of common function blocks for motor starting, alarm handling, and valve control. Programs can be uploaded, downloaded, and saved to the internal EEPROM for permanent storage.
A built‑in RS‑485 port allows connection to external HMIs or SCADA systems via Modbus RTU. The USB port is used for programming and firmware updates. The controller can be expanded with additional I/O modules from the D‑series family if more points are needed.
Typical applications include: control of small conveyor belts, packaging machines, drying ovens, pump and fan sequencing, alarm annunciation, and simple machine safeguarding. It is also used in compressor accessory control, such as automatic condensate drains and filtration systems.
The D303‑DL‑BASIC is built with industrial‑grade components and has a MTBF of over 80,000 hours. It has no internal moving parts and requires no routine maintenance except for periodic battery replacement for the RTC (every 5 years).
The controller includes a hardware watchdog that forces outputs to a safe state in case of processor fault. Emergency stop inputs can be wired directly to a safety relay, with the controller monitoring the status.
